A tour of Puri and Bhubaneswar offers a rich blend of spirituality, history, and coastal beauty. Start in Bhubaneswar, Odisha’s capital, known as the "City of Temples," where you can explore ancient temples like Lingaraj and Mukteshwar, showcasing exquisite Kalinga architecture. Continue to Puri, a revered pilgrimage site, home to the famous Jagannath Temple and the beautiful Puri Beach. Experience the vibrant Rath Yatra festival, and visit the Sun Temple in nearby Konark, a UNESCO World Heritage site. This tour provides a deep dive into Odisha’s cultural heritage, spiritual significance, and natural splendor.

One of the beautiful esteem tourist destinations in Himachal Pradesh, India, is Kullu. It is a beautiful scenery locale with orchards of apples, a meandering Beas River, and campsites for camping. Camping and rafting in rivers will provide the best experience for the Tourist Places within Kullu.
Raghunathji Temple: Festivals like Dussehra, Shivratri, Navratri, etc are celebrated with great enthusiasm. The chief deity of Kullu Valley is Lord Raghunath or Lord Rama.
Bijli Mahadev Temple: A temple on top of a hill. Bijli Mahadev Temple, which is supposed to have a strike of lightening every year.
Manikaran: Manikaran is a pilgrimage for Hindus and Sikhs and is famous for its hot springs with healing properties.

Lithuania - Hill of Crosses
It’s a catholic pilgrimage site, not known by certain when or by whom it started. What is believed is in the 19th century people started bringing crosses to the site of a former hill fort. Probably in memory of perished rebels, who fight against the Russian Empire. Aundha Nagnath Temple: A Revered Shrine of Lord Shiva
Aundha Nagnath Temple, located in Maharashtra, is a famous pilgrimage site dedicated to Lord Shiva. It is believed to be one of the twelve Jyotirlingas (lingams of light) in India. Devotees flock to this temple to seek the blessings of Lord Shiva and experience its divine aura. TOURISM IN INDIA
Tourism in India is 4.6% of the country's GDP. Unlike other sectors, is not a priority sector for Government of India. Forbes magazine ranked India as the 7th most beautiful country in 'The 50 Most Beautiful Countries In The World' rankings.[1] The World Travel and Tourism Council calculated that tourism generated ₹13.2 lakh crore (US$170 billion) or 5.8% of India's GDP and supported 32.1 million jobs in 2021. Even though, these numbers were lower than the pre-pandemic figures; the country's economy witnessed a significant growth in 2021 after the massive downturn during 2020. El Santuario de Chimayó is a Roman Catholic church in Chimayó, New Mexico, United States. (Santuario is Spanish for "sanctuary".) This shrine, a National Historic Landmark, is famous for the story of its founding and as a contemporary pilgrimage site. It receives almost 300,000 visitors per year and has been called "no doubt the most important Catholic pilgrimage center in the United States.” The Santuario is on Juan Medina Drive in Chimayó. It is entered through a walled courtyard. Built of adobe with a bell tower on each side, the church is 60 feet long and 24 feet wide with walls more than 3 feet thick. Pointed caps on the towers and a metal pitched roof (blocking the clerestory) were added after 1917, probably in the 1920s. The "elegant" doors were carved by the 19th-century carpenter Pedro Domínguez. An unusual feature is two side-by-side rooms at the entrance forming a vestibule or narthex, once used for storage. The nave contains a crucifix representing Christ of Esquipulas, 6 feet tall. Other notable folk-art decorations include five reredoses and a small sculpture of St. James the Great. A small room called el pocito (the little well) contains a round pit, the source of "holy dirt" (tierra bendita) that is believed to have healing powers. An adjacent Prayer Room displays many ex-votos as well as photographs, discarded crutches, and other testimonials of those purportedly healed.
